Sidebar Left Template for Business Analyst Resume (2026)

Business analysts' value lies at the intersection of technical tooling and business communication. The Sidebar Left template visually represents this duality—your technical arsenal (SQL, BI tools, modeling platforms) sits prominently on the left where recruiters scan first for qualification fit, while the main column carries your collaborative achievements and business impact narratives. This layout is especially effective for BAs at technology companies where hiring managers expect both technical proficiency and stakeholder management skill, and need to assess both quickly. The two-column structure also helps ATS systems separate skills metadata from narrative descriptions.

Customization Tips for Business Analysts

How to tailor the Sidebar Left template specifically for Business Analyst roles:

1

Lead the sidebar with technical skills grouped by category: Data (SQL, Python, R), Visualization (Tableau, Power BI, Looker), Collaboration (Jira, Confluence, Miro), Methodology (Agile, BABOK, UML).

2

Include business methodology with certification context: 'Requirements Elicitation (CBAP certified)', 'Process Modeling (BPMN 2.0)', 'User Story Mapping'—certifications amplify methodology claims.

3

Add analysis tools with proficiency depth: 'SQL (complex joins, window functions, CTEs)', 'Tableau (published 20+ dashboards)', 'Excel (VBA, pivot tables, VLOOKUP/INDEX-MATCH)'—specificity beats listing.

4

In the main column, emphasize impact with the analysis→action→outcome arc: 'Analyzed 3 years of customer churn data, identified pricing as primary driver, recommended tiered pricing model that reduced churn from 8% to 5.2%.'

5

Show requirements quality metrics: user stories written per sprint (volume), acceptance criteria completeness rate, requirements defect rate—these are the BA-specific KPIs hiring managers evaluate.

6

Demonstrate cross-functional influence: workshops facilitated (with attendee count), executive presentations delivered, change management plans authored—BAs are connectors, and the sidebar format highlights both the technical and human dimensions.
